Pair of trouser panels of hand woven cotton embroidered in red, green, yellow and cream silk and metal thread. The panel is divided into vertical stripes by bands of woven hem-stitching. The stripes are filled alternately with a stylised three-pronged tree design and a small motif resembling flower buds.
